获取除第一个之外的所有输入参数

时间:2015-09-08 12:01:07

标签: shell

amount.ToString("C", new CultureInfo("de-DE"))

我只想得到$ 2 $ 3 $ 4 ... $ n(不含$ 1) 我所做的一切都有效,但似乎有点矫枉过正。

有一种简单的方法吗?

1 个答案:

答案 0 :(得分:2)

你可以使用:

shift

删除传递给脚本的第一个参数。

根据help shift

help shift
shift: shift [n]
    Shift positional parameters.

    Rename the positional parameters $N+1,$N+2 ... to $1,$2 ...  If N is
    not given, it is assumed to be 1.

    Exit Status:
    Returns success unless N is negative or greater than $#.